According to Firstsportz, Angel Reese knows that the media connects her with her fans. However, during the offseason, she stepped away from cameras, microphones, and reporters. She announced her league exit through her own podcast instead of attending the traditional team press conference.

“Even before the game, I fear what the media will ask. It could be the best question, but it will get twisted or framed differently… I don’t want to do an interview with anyone. Sometimes I’d rather accept the fine than talk to the media,” Reese said on her podcast.
With this move, the Chicago Sky star avoided exposing herself to unwanted questions about her future, especially after how her second WNBA season ended, which was not pleasant.
Rather than risk saying something wrong or getting uncomfortable with future-focused questions, she chose to step back. It was a bold and smart decision, even though it would cost her a fine.
